Transaction 502aa61b383ae85fc71ff519f1bf75e4c00bc3bb8d36ac730d12a18fd2df030c

43 Input
1 Outputs
  • 502aa61b383ae85fc71ff519f1bf75e4c00bc3bb8d36ac730d12a18fd2df030c:0
  • value  34961002
    address  3L1p2tUHPwrRN3qgf4Hm1R73e29hFshbnp